*Global Vehicle Systems (GVS)* is a Tier 2 supplier of precision automation and finishing technology to the automotive industry. Located in Tilbury, Ontario, we pride ourselves in building custom integrated automation equipment, and providing Class A production painting and injection molding expertise.

*This role is responsible for:*
* All aspects of the Electrical & Pneumatic Build of Custom Automated Equipment, including, but not limited to Panel Build, Field Wiring, Pneumatic Plumbing of Cylinders, Start-up, Commissioning, Installation & Service.
* Promote and enforce a safe, clean, organized and healthy work environment through planned work habits in accordance with Provincial Labour Regulations, Health and Safety Regulations and company policies and procedures.
* Be an active team member from the initiation phase of the project through the complete life cycle of the project including installation, service and warranty.
* Understand all specifications of the project.
* Ensure that systems and processes are consistently used so that every job is adequately planned for and executed according to project specifications from project kick-off to the project completion. This includes the following:
* When called upon, taking part in internal design review meetings.
* Work with the Controls Designer/Programmer, Manufacturing Manager and Project Manager to make recommendations for: ease of wiring and/or assembly; methods of cost savings; and ease of set-up.
* Work with the Controls Designer/Programmer to identify what BOM items are in stock and can be used in the Controls Design.
* Complete a thorough review of the Controls Design Package with the Controls Designer/Programmer assigned to the project.
* Work with the Project Manager, Manufacturing Manager and the Controls Designer/Programmer to provide estimates on the number of hours it will take to complete the Controls aspect of the project.
* Communicate with Project Manager, Manufacturing Manager, Controls Designer/Programmer, and the other project team members on a regular basis to discuss project status, open issues, and project changes. \* Perform any the panel wiring, field wiring and pneumatic assembly required during the progress of the job build
* Work with the Controls Technicians and Designer/Programmer to start-up & commission the equipment.
* When called upon, travel to the customer?s facility and provide installation, set-up, and support of the equipment
* Work with the other project team members, as required, through the set-up and de-bug of the equipment with customer parts and the preparation of the equipment for run-off.
* Provide technical support, as required, during the run-off of the equipment.
* Assist Department & Project Managers to ensure Job budget targets are met, or exceeded.
* Ensure that any recognized Scientific Research & Experimental Development (SR&ED) opportunities throughout the course of the project are adequately documented
* Assist the management team to determine a build schedule
* Work with the other project team members to resolve any open issues on the equipment prior to shipment.
* Attend any meetings as requested
* Assist the production team in troubleshooting and solving production & quality problems
* Participate, as required, in the research, trial/development, selection of new technology to improve the products provided to our customers
* Assist the Global Vehicle Systems team in ensuring that the quality of our product(s) meet or exceed the customer?s expectations.
